The Science of Bending: Understanding Thermal Expansion

When a pan is exposed to high temperatures, the metal expands and contracts. This process, known as thermal expansion, can cause the pan to warp or bend if it’s not designed to withstand the stress. The rate of expansion varies depending on the material, with some metals expanding more than others. For example, aluminum pans tend to expand more than stainless steel or cast iron pans, making them more prone to bending.

To mitigate the effects of thermal expansion, manufacturers use various techniques, such as adding reinforcing materials, using thicker metal, or designing the pan with a curved or angled shape. However, even with these precautions, pans can still bend if they’re not used correctly. Overheating, sudden temperature changes, or uneven heating can all contribute to a bent pan. By understanding the science behind thermal expansion, you can take steps to prevent your pan from bending and ensure it lasts for years to come.

Choosing the Right Pan: Materials, Thickness, and Construction

Not all pans are created equal, and some are more resistant to bending than others. The material, thickness, and construction of a pan all play a critical role in determining its durability and resistance to warping.

For example, cast iron pans are known for their exceptional strength and durability, making them less prone to bending. On the other hand, aluminum pans are more lightweight and prone to warping, especially if they’re not constructed with reinforcing materials. Stainless steel pans fall somewhere in between, offering a good balance of durability and affordability.

When choosing a pan, consider the type of cooking you’ll be doing most often. If you’re a high-heat cook, you may want to opt for a pan made from a more durable material, such as cast iron or stainless steel. If you’re a low-heat cook, a thinner, more lightweight pan may be sufficient. Additionally, look for pans with a sturdy construction, such as a thick bottom or a reinforced handle, as these can help prevent bending and warping.
